Default No flat rule for every place

If you're in a place during gun season with the green leaves on the trees; its a solid tree area; and its warm, you're better off up in a tree stand. In such a place the deer can scent you a lot faster than you can see them.

In cold conditions, with the leaves off the trees, I usually hunted on the ground. Up in a tree in those conditions, you can sure catch more frigid wind. On private land, with some open area mixed with forested land, I might consider it. Wall to wall tree area; rarely in cold conditions.
